Well, 44 lbs down, prolonged dieting and a lot of cardio - you might need a bit of a diet break. When was the last time you had one? If you haven't, you might consider bringing up your calories, slowly, for a few weeks or a month while you get stronger in the gym and discover maintenance.
Also, you're following up on your hormones, right? I can't remember if you're on thyroid or not.

Been Stuck at this 244 289 weight for about 3 weeks now.
weight loss / hormone Dr I have been seeing says to add weights to increase low T and to lower Estradiol levels. I asked about HRT and he isn't convinced yet.
My T levels have been going down since I started weight loss
2-23-2010 First Blood work was total T only 375 ng/dL scale 250-1100ng/dL
Started serious weight management program 4-6-2010
7-22-2010 Second Blood work Total T 276 ngdL scale 250-1100
8-16-2010 third blood work
total T 270 250-1100 ng/dL
T free % 2.11 150-2.20
free T 57.0 35.-155. pg.ml
estradiol 51 range 13-54 pg/mL
Just did another blood work yesterday for Total and free T and Estradiol. the lab takes about 14 days for results
